Community Financial System, Inc. (NYSE:CBU – Get Free Report) Director Mark Bolus sold 12,191 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Thursday, June 25th. The stock was sold at an average price of $67.00, for a total value of $816,797.00. Following the sale, the director owned 94,060 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$6,302,020. The trade was a 11.47%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through this hyperlink.

Community Financial System (NYSE:CBU –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, April 29th. The bank reported $1.15 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.10 by $0.05. The business had revenue of $213.69 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$216.36 million. Community Financial System had a return on equity of 11.24% and a net margin of 21.26%.The firm’s revenue was up 8.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.98 earnings per share. As a group, analysts forecast that Community Financial System, Inc. will post 4.74 earnings per share for the current year.

Community Financial System Company Profile
Community Financial System (NYSE: CBU) is the bank holding company for Community Bank, National Association, a full-service commercial bank headquartered in DeWitt, New York. Through its principal subsidiary, the company offers a range of banking and financial services designed to meet the needs of both consumer and business clients. Its organizational structure centers on community-based banking operations supported by centralized technology, risk management and administrative functions.
The company’s product offerings include deposit accounts, residential and commercial mortgage loans, commercial and consumer lending, treasury and cash management services, and electronic banking.
